Interlock® Aluminum Roofing — all-climates performance specs for Forest Glen, Illinois
| Spec / Rating | Climate / Risk Factor + What It Solves |
|---|---|
| Wind resistance: 120+ mph (193+ kph) | Extreme wind, hurricanes, storm uplift: full interlocking attachment helps prevent blow-offs, edge lifting, and panel loss in high-gust events. |
| Fire rating: Class A (with proper assembly) | Wildfire, embers, radiant heat, chimney sparks: non-combustible roof assembly provides the highest residential fire protection rating. |
| Hail resistance: UL 2218 Class 4 | Hail and impact debris: highest impact classification; resists cracking, splitting, and surface loss common with asphalt under hail strikes. |
| Snow & ice performance: interlocking, shedding profile | Heavy snow, freeze-thaw, ice dams: smooth aluminum sheds snow efficiently and the interlocking design helps block water intrusion when melt-refreeze cycles occur. (Final snow-load capacity depends on roof structure and local code.) |
| Corrosion resistance: aluminum (won’t rust) | Salt air, coastal humidity, wet climates: aluminum naturally resists rust and corrosion, reducing long-term failure risk in marine or high-moisture environments. |
| Heat / UV durability: baked-on coating system | High heat, intense sun, thermal cycling: coatings resist UV breakdown and temperature-swing fatigue, slowing fading and surface degradation. |
| Moss / algae resistance: smooth coated surface | Wet shade, organic growth: low-porosity metal surface gives moss/algae less to grip, reducing staining and maintenance. |
| Material: heavy-gauge aluminum roof profiles (Slate / Shake / Shingle / Tile / Standing Seam) | All-season structural stability: lightweight, dent-resistant metal system stays stable through large hot-cold swings and severe weather. |
| Expected lifespan: 50+ years | Long-term durability across climates: avoids re-roof cycles typical of shorter-life materials, even in high-stress environments. |
| Warranty: Lifetime-Limited, non-prorated + 50-year transferable | Lifetime protection + resale value: guarantees long-term material confidence and transfers to future owners. |

Will a metal roof hold up through Forest Glen's freeze-thaw cycles?
Yes. Aluminum expands and contracts with temperature swings, but its oxide layer self-heals when micro-scratched—a key advantage over steel in your 82 annual freeze-thaw days. The roofing-grade 3105-H24 and 3003-H24 aluminum alloy (ASTM B209) resists corrosion because aluminum contains no iron and cannot rust. Four-way interlocking panels move as one system, distributing stress evenly, so material fatigue from repeated freezing around Cook County's 73 cm snow isn't a structural concern like it is with rigid tile or slate.
How does a metal roof handle heavy snow and ice dams in Illinois?
Metal roofing sheds snow faster than asphalt because the smooth surface and thermal properties prevent ice dam formation—critical in areas averaging 993 mm rain and 73 cm snow yearly. The four-way interlocking panels lock snow in place until it slides as a unit, and optional snow guards can be installed to manage release. At roughly 0.41 to 0.59 lb/sq ft depending on profile, the roof is so light that snow loads never require structural reinforcement, unlike slate or concrete tile. Ice can't bond to the sealed Alunar finish the way it does to asphalt.
Why should I choose aluminum roofing instead of steel in a rainy climate?
Aluminum cannot rust because it contains no iron—the element that oxidizes and corrodes in steel roofing. Instead, aluminum develops a paper-thin oxide layer that self-heals when scratched, giving it natural corrosion resistance even through Cook County's wet winters (993 mm annual rain). The Alunar 70% PVDF fluorocarbon finish, applied to both sides of every panel and warranted 30 years against chalking and fading, adds a second protective barrier. This dual-layer defense is why Interlock panels have been installed successfully from coastal salt-air homes to an Antarctic research station since 1998.

Do I need to reinforce my home's structure for a metal roof?
No reinforcement is needed. Interlock metal roofing is extraordinarily light—the Slate and Cedar Shingle profiles install at roughly 0.41 lb/sq ft, while the Mediterranean Tile profile is approximately 96% lighter than concrete or clay tile yet delivers the same aesthetic. This feather-light weight allows installation directly over most existing roofs, saving you the cost and mess of a tear-off. Your home's framing can support the new roof with no structural upgrades, a major cost and timeline advantage over traditional slate or tile. This is why the ICC-ES ESR-1790 approval emphasizes lightweight installation compatibility.
Is metal roofing worth the upfront cost over asphalt in the long run?
Metal roofing is the last roof you'll buy. Asphalt shingles typically last 15–20 years and require tear-off, haul-away, and landfill costs every cycle; Interlock carries a lifetime limited, non-prorated material warranty for the original owner and is transferable to the next owner for 50 years from completion. Over a 50-year timeline, you avoid three to four asphalt replacements, plus labor and disposal. The roofing-grade aluminum alloy resists the 82 annual freeze-thaw cycles in Cook County without degrading, and the 30-year Alunar coating warranty protects against chalking. When you factor in energy savings from energy-efficient colors, potential insurance discounts, and resale value, the per-year cost favors metal significantly.
Can a metal roof actually reduce my cooling costs?
Yes, if you select an energy-efficient color. Interlock offers Cool Roof Rating Council-rated profiles with thermal emissivity up to 0.84 and initial solar reflectance up to 0.55 (Aged Copper Penny), meaning they reflect heat that asphalt absorbs. In Forest Glen's 3,051 annual sunshine hours, this reflective property reduces cooling demand by redirecting solar energy away from your home's interior. While Illinois winters are long (73 cm snow, 82 freeze-thaw days), the summer and shoulder seasons benefit measurably. energy-efficiency certification confirms these reflectance properties meet federal efficiency standards, and the benefit compounds over decades.
